Agency launches Build To Rent taskforce with new brand name

Leaders Romans Group has announced the creation of a Build To Rent Taskforce, using a different brand name - Three Sixty Space.

A statement says Three Sixty Space “brings together wide-ranging expertise from across LRG,including land acquisition and disposal, planning, sustainability, new homes development, lettings agency, property management and block management. As such, it provides a consistent service to support the increasing number of investors, developers and property managers who make BTR the UK’s fastest-growing property asset class.”

British Property Federation figures report 14 per cent annual growth from 2021 to 2022 and a strong four per cent for the most recent reported quarter.

LRG says that in the past 10 years BTR has evolved from providing city centre apartment blocks for young professionals to substantial suburban communities with shared services and facilities, apparently popular with all age groups. And LRG says that it’s network of 225 offices make it ideal to address this growing BTR demand.

Andrew Jones - who has the title of Group Director, Corporate Lettings & Build to Rent at LRG - says: “Recent research amongst global institution investors has found that 70 per cent anticipated being active within BTR suburban communities in the next five years: a substantial increase from the 42 per cent currently active.” 

He continues: “The sector’s potential is almost unlimited, as counter-urbanising maturing Millennials seek family homes in serviced communities and benefit from the opportunity to move from one home to another at little cost as their family grows. This innovative, service-based product will compare favourably with most of the stock currently available for rent, and its popularity will enable BTR suburban communities to attract additional investment and grow at pace.

“But unabated expansion will require the values of traditional BTR to be maintained. LRG’s specialist BTR taskforce was constructed on the basis of consistency. The service, which spans land and planning, specialist management and lettings, strategic advice and data analysis, provides services to investors, housebuilders and PRS operators throughout the process.

“From land acquisition and Local Plan allocations, to understanding local markets and providing service to fix a dripping tap, LRG spans a vast range of expertise, enabling us to provide that much-needed consistency.”
